编程逐渐步入了人们的生活当中,那些不是做程序员的也懂一些编程,貌似在美国就算不是程序员也都要掌握一些编程技术。时代的进步,科技的发展,编程是否会列入必修课呢?当然这个还是敬请期待吧,哈哈哈。编程是做什么的呢?编程就是敲代码,拼凑字母,编程也是一门艺术。
站在科学的角度来看,编程是逻辑思维能力的一种体现,各类编程语言都有自己的逻辑,一个程序的运行也是基于逻辑的运行来完成的。正如操作手机一样,你通过自己的逻辑和步骤一步一步操作手机,手机上的这个过程才会完成,再比如说王者荣耀,游戏肯定不是随随便便打的,随便打也是不会赢的,需要你的逻辑,控制你的手,操作角色的动作,攻击敌方防御塔,摧毁敌方水晶你才会胜利,这个过程才算走完。
当成艺术的话可以用编程写出优美的作品,或者代码段优美好看也是可以的。其实艺术的体现还有很多,就比如说我们使用的电脑,电脑显示内容是通过编程实现的、电脑里面的应用少不了编程,大家使用的手机系统,少不了编程,并且手机里面的各种应用比如:app,小程序等都是通过编程实现的。
编程也是灵活进行的,编程不能只是认为代码是死的,代码确实是死的,但是每个程序员的大脑都是活的。每个程序员都期望将自己的代码写的美化,将自己做的效果艺术化。并且每个程序员跟每个程序员编程的风格不同,每个人都是独一无二的,每个人都有自己的一技之长。
目前大学的课程中也是少不了编程的,一般计算机二级就涉及java和c语言的知识,大学还开设了计算机软件,软件工程,移动互联应用技术等专业课,这些专业课就是专业性的讲述编程,此外里面还涉及一些实战的编程项目,编程项目中多数考验逻辑能力,还可能会用到一些数学方面的东西。学编程的人需要具备一定的逻辑思维能力,这样就能更好的参与进来,加入编程这个行业。
编程又像建筑行业的工程,框架是必然的,每次编程首先就是先把框架搭好,然后在完善内部的一些东西,一些代码片段。本质上说编成就是软件工程。
当然每个人对待编程都会有自己的见解,总体来说编程的本质也是更好的解决各种问题,还能够帮助人们更好的生活。所以编程逐渐普及,人人会编程,程序员逐渐增多了,更多的人喜欢上了编程并逐渐进入编程这个行业。